But your constructor calls loadXML_proj(), so all the code in that
function is executed while prjLoad is being constructed.  This does not
differ in any significant way from executing the same code in the
constructor.

Jesse Pelton wrote:
> 
> You might want to start by trapping all the exceptions that parse()
can
> generate.  DOMException, OutOfMemoryException, and (I think)
> SAXException are all possibilities that you haven't covered.  Using
the
> getMessage() member to display the exception message may well be
> revealing.
> 
> Personally, I'd think twice before implementing a constructor that
does
> so much work.  Handling exceptions properly in constructors is
> notoriously difficult, and this one is rife with opportunities for
> error.
